The 2024 Supercoppa Italiana will be the 37th edition of the Supercoppa Italiana, the Italian football super cup.[1][2]

Qualification

The tournament will feature the winners and runners-up of the 2023–24 Serie A and 2023–24 Coppa Italia.[1][2]

Qualified teams

The following four teams qualified for the tournament. Atalanta qualified for the first time in their history.[1][2]

Format

The competition featured two semi-finals to determine the two teams to play in the final. All three matches were played in a single-leg fixture. Matches consisted of two periods of 45 minutes each. In the case of a tie, the matches were decided by a penalty shoot-out.[1][2]

Venue

The matches are scheduled to be played in Saudi Arabia for the third year running.[1][2]
